Output 2943c51ad58c02d78891c157d0c2ddb5b22c32364cb0fa5ce6e619b1b43945c6:0

value
607000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a9a03f69cc6830b09b0fb074b9c8e10d2b5a3f9 OP_EQUAL
address
32f5BePADoxxpZY6AU8SZYkD2b1nJHhKxx
transaction
2943c51ad58c02d78891c157d0c2ddb5b22c32364cb0fa5ce6e619b1b43945c6
spent
true